Sector Welcomes Burnham's Pledge to Tackle Social Care "Once and For All" Prime Minister Andy Burnham’s pledge to reform adult social care and overhaul how it is funded has been broadly welcomed by sector leaders and organisations. Mr Burham said he did not want to leave office having failed to tackle the nation's social care crisis, pledging to "use some of my political capital" on an issue close to his heart. Speaking to the media upon taking office Mr Burnham spoke about his father

having Alzheimer's disease and how often those people who should be looked after in a social care setting were using an already stretched public health service for help. He said he wanted social care to "operate on the NHS principle" of being free at the point of use, describing the current system as "broken".
